Archivos del Domingo, 20 de Agosto de 2006

Aplicaciones GTK en Java

Domingo, 20 de Agosto de 2006 a las

Hace tiempo leí acerca de Kommander, un lenguaje de scripting gráfico para KDE y tras terminar aquella gran práctica de programación, me entró la curiosidad de cómo se harían programas para GNOME y KDE, qué lenguaje era el utilizado, librerías y herramientas necesarias, etc…

Buscando por ahí encontré que aunque un escritorio esté escrito en C no es necesario programar en C aplicaciones compatibles con ese escritorio por lo que hay unos bindings para diversos lenguajes que junto con GKT+ te permiten crear aplicaciones rápidamente.

Es el caso de Java-GNOME, un conjunto de bindings y librerías GTK+ que permiten escribir programas GNOME en Java. Pero lo mejor es combinarlo con un IDE como Eclipse y con un diseñador de interfaces como Glade. De esa forma creas la interfaz gráfica en un momento y te puedes centrar en programar el nucleo del programa en condiciones y con la ventaja de que no dependes de Swing para nada, sino que delegas en Glib y GTK, necesario en la máquina en la que ejecutes el programa.

Para aclarar un poco las cosas he encontrado una demo de hace algún tiempo de Java-GNOME.

Java-GNOME demo

Impresionado me he quedado con Glade… wowow.

Para KDE existen tambien Java bindings, con Koala a la cabeza.

En cuanto pasen exámenes me pondré al menos a probarlo :)

Archivado en Web
por elsamu